Generic labels hide the specific food you serve

Many owners pick a broad term like feast or abundance because it feels safe for a varied menu. This choice blends your business into a sea of similar signs that promise everything but specify nothing. Customers scanning the strip mall cannot tell if you specialize in hibachi, sushi, or standard American fare. You lose the chance to attract the diner who wants a specific cuisine experience. A name like Mediterranean Made signals a clear direction before the guest walks through the door. It sets an expectation for olive oil and grilled vegetables rather than generic fried items.

Cute puns slow down the lunch rush line

A clever play on words might look good on a business card but fails when the phone rings during the noon spike. Staff members struggle to spell or pronounce a tricky title over the noise of clattering trays and sizzling skillets. Regulars want to recommend your spot to friends without stumbling over the syntax. Keep the syllables simple so the reservation book stays accurate and the delivery apps list you correctly. Check that the domain is available for your chosen spelling before you print the menus. The generator does not check trademarks, so verify legal clearance with a professional.

Questions people ask

Should I include the word buffet in the name?
You do not need to use the word if your concept is clear from other terms like grill or kitchen. Many successful spots use words like spread or station to imply self-service without stating it directly. This approach can make your brand feel more modern and less institutional.
How long should a buffet business name be?
Most signs display two words, which is enough space to combine a style with a descriptor. Single-word names are bold but often require more marketing budget to explain the concept. Aim for clarity so drivers and pedestrians can read it quickly from the road.
Can I use a possessive form like Miller's Buffet?
About seven out of 100 businesses use this structure to create a sense of family ownership. It works well if you want to emphasize home-style cooking or personal service. Ensure the name is easy to say aloud when customers refer you to their neighbors.
